Patent number: 11040130Abstract: A filter medium includes two porous zones arranged in the form of a stack that include (i) a first porous zone, called “prefiltration”, treated with at least one reagent presenting affinity for red blood cells and leading to red blood cells being captured or agglutinated on the prefiltration zone; and (ii) a second porous zone, called “asymmetric”, presenting pore size that decreases transversely to its thickness, the portion of higher pore size being positioned towards the prefiltration zone.Type: GrantFiled: July 12, 2019Date of Patent: June 22, 2021Assignee: BIOMERIEUXInventor: Frederic Foucault

Patent number: 9371924Abstract: A one-piece flap device made of elastic material, which separates two distinct volume spaces. The one-piece flap device includes: a) a substantially cylindrical body including a through conduit, b) a flap that seals an aperture of the through conduit of the body when the flap is in a closed position and is within said body, and c) an arm connecting the body of the device to the flap. The arm is in an elastic stress position regardless of the position of the flap when inside said body.Type: GrantFiled: February 15, 2011Date of Patent: June 21, 2016Assignee: BIOMERIEUXInventor: Frederic Foucault
